Amazon has 24-Pack 2.75-Oz Meow Mix Wet Cat Food (Various) on sale for $14.98 - $3 (20% off when you clip the coupon) - $0.75 (5% off when you checkout via Subscribe & Save) = $11.23. Shipping is free w/ Prime or on $35+ orders.Thanks to Deal Hunter babgaly for finding this deal.

Quote from DramaLlama211 :
I don't know how the wet food is, but the only bag of dry food that's ever made my cat throw up has been Meow Mix. It's cheap for a reason.
My cats have that problem too. My vet said it's because of the high amount of soy and corn meal they put in it. Also some variations of Friskies does it also. This is for their dry food, the wet food they seem to keep down except in the spring when they're hocking up hair from their winter coats coming off, but it doesnt matter what brand I use to stop that.

Quote from desynergy :
My cats have that problem too. My vet said it's because of the high amount of soy and corn meal they put in it. Also some variations of Friskies does it also. This is for their dry food, the wet food they seem to keep down except in the spring when they're hocking up hair from their winter coats coming off, but it doesnt matter what brand I use to stop that.

I've also had issues with Meow Mix or Friskies dry food. They're fine with Meow Mix wet though (although they're picky and only eat shreds).

For dry food, I try to avoid grains, soy, fillers, and food coloring, and I stick with higher protein food (40+% protein).
